Abstract

MANET is wireless network.ad hoc network. Many devices are directly communicate with each other through
wireless network. In ad hoc network, node acts as a router to send and receive the data. The advantage of the
system is robustness, flexibility. An ad hoc network is local area network that builds an automatic connection to
the nodes in the network. An ad-hoc network is a collection of wireless mobile hosts forming a temporary network
without any pre-existing infrastructure. In this paper is to provide a review of MANET including its application or
benefits along with the different types of routing protocols used for communication in MANET.
